Ceiling speakers, etc. are used for maximizing effects in
Dolby Atmos or Dolby Surround listening mode. Install
Top Front speakers midway between the position just
above the listening position and the position just above
the front speakers. Install Top Middle speakers just above
the listening position. Install Top Rear speakers midway
between the position just above the listening position and
the position just above the surround back speakers.
Combination patterns for Height speakers 1 and 2
Dolby recommends the following combination pattern
to obtain the best effect of Dolby Atmos and Dolby
Surround listening modes.
Pair 1: Top Middle
Pair 2: Top Front / Top Rear
The following are the patterns of Height speakers 2 that
can be selected according to the type of Height speakers 1.
Height speakers1: Front High
Height speakers 2: Not Use/Top Middle/Rear High/Dolby
Enabled Speaker (Surround)/Dolby Enabled Speaker (Back)
Height speakers1: Top Front
Height speakers 2: Not Use/Top Rear
Height speakers1: Top Middle
Height speakers 2 cannot be used.
Height speakers1: Dolby Enabled Speaker (Front)
Height speakers 2: Not Use/Dolby Enabled Speaker
(Surround)/Dolby Enabled Speaker (Back)
Height speakers1: Dolby Enabled Speaker (Surround)
Height speakers 2 cannot be used.
Height speakers1: Dolby Enabled Speaker (Back)
Height speakers 2 cannot be used.
When front speakers are bi-amp connected, you can select
a pattern for Height speakers 2 from the following options.
Not Use/Front High/Top Front/Top Middle/Dolby Enabled
Speaker (Front)/Dolby Enabled Speaker (Surround)/
Dolby Enabled Speaker (Back)

Notes for Speaker Connection
This unit works as an AV controller when connected with
a separately sold multichannel power amplifier. Connect
a power amplifier to the PRE OUT RCA jack or PRE OUT
XLR jack of the unit and then connect the power amplifier
with speakers. For how to connect the power amplifier
with speakers, refer to the instruction manual of the
multichannel power amplifier
Set the crossover frequency, speaker distance and other
settings on this unit.

Connecting the multichannel power amplifier
to the PRE OUT RCA jack
Connect the multichannel power amplifier to the PRE OUT
RCA jack. Connect the unit and power amplifier with an
RCA cable.
